Transaction 66ff49c8a3b14c3e390b26538cf501d707d1a33a8125d16bea8ca78db983ac22

1 Input
2 Outputs
  • 66ff49c8a3b14c3e390b26538cf501d707d1a33a8125d16bea8ca78db983ac22:0
  • value  17910000
    address  3BxyciVVjBKFW5bqz6MqFKyDkEW9j7DJzb
  • 66ff49c8a3b14c3e390b26538cf501d707d1a33a8125d16bea8ca78db983ac22:1
  • value  586247720
    address  18SwRZGb2xyS3xxFGFa42dr4Y9MRCmVb5M